Senior Nurse Anesthetist Salary in Camden, NJ: $354,654 (2026)
Quick Answer:The top tier of nurse anesthetists working in Camden, NJ — those at or above the 90th percentile — pull in $354,654/year or more for 2026, based on BLS OEWS 2025 estimates for SOC 29-1151. Strip back Camden's price premium (BEA RPP 115.2, 15% above national) and that top-decile pay carries the same buying power as $307,859 in average-cost America. The 45% spread above city median typically rewards 7+ years of practice or specialty credentials.

Maximizing Your Nurse Anesthetist Earnings in Camden
Within Camden, particular areas of specialization can significantly influence a senior nurse anesthetist's earning potential. For instance, expertise in pediatric anesthesia, obstetric anesthesia, or cardiac anesthesia can command premium salaries due to the complex nature of these cases. Compensation also varies markedly depending on the setting; CRNAs working in hospital systems often enjoy comprehensive benefits and job security, while those associated with locum tenens agencies may have the flexibility and higher pay associated with independent contracting. Advancing into leadership roles—such as becoming a chief CRNA or department director—can provide additional financial and professional rewards. Additionally, obtaining further credentials like a Doctorate of Nursing Practice (DNP) or specialty fellowships significantly boosts earning capacity. With compensation structures also reflecting factors like call coverage and OR efficiency bonuses, the senior nurse anesthetist pay in NJ reinforces the significance of expertise in a complex healthcare environment.
